This is useful if you like to take advantage of the game’s crafting system. Most of the rewards you will get from giving a ticket to the Bellhop will be junk. Before you can reach them, you will need to complete the Key to the Past mission. They can be found on the other side of the laser grid in the basement. The NPC you are looking for is the Bellhop Protectron. Be careful of the Scorched that roam the area. Once you reach the ski resort, head inside and make your way to the basement. This is the area next to the Top of the World in the center of the Savage Divide region. If you haven’t guessed it, you can redeem these tickets at Pleasant Valley Ski Resort. Related: How to get and spend Claim Tokens in Fallout 76 How to redeem Pleasant Valley Claim Tickets Unfortunately, that is the only way to get your hands on this currency. Feral Ghouls have a two percent chance of dropping a Pleasant Valley Claim Ticket when killed. You can find Feral Ghouls in areas like Flatwoods, Whitespring Resort, and Fort Defiance. Odds are you have seen plenty of these enemies running across the map as you’ve made your way through Appalachia. The short answer to claiming these tickets is to kill Feral Ghouls. These tickets can get you some good rewards as long as you know how to gather them and where to redeem them. That DLC brought in new forms of currency with one of the lesser-known ones being the Pleasant Valley Claim Tickets. When a player attacks, the ‘Attack on Workshop’ event triggers, igniting PvP between the controlling player and the attacking player. On top of the waves of AI-controlled enemies, hostile players may feel the need to assault your efforts, too. If you successfully defend the workshop, you’ll receive crafting plans, ammunition, purified water, and Stimpaks. To successfully defend your claim, kill all of the enemies plaguing the area. When they launch their assault, you’ll receive the ‘Defend Workshop’ event. It’s common to endure attacks from random waves of enemies while controlling a workshop. You won’t waste raw materials from your inventory to finally stock up on ammunition for your pipe pistols. Any items you craft while within the sphere of influence comes from the workshop’s resource pool, not your own. While you control a workshop, remember to craft. For your efforts, you’ll also enjoy an abunance of crafting supplies, like Medicine, Ammo, Fusion Cores, and raw materials, like ores. No, the benefits of contesting a workshop are not limited to experience points and the thrill of PvP. You Might Also Like: How to Level Up Fast in Fallout 76 Fallout 76’s Workshop Benefits While fighting off hordes of enemies and players keen on taking what you have, you need to build up the workshop surroundings to take advantage of raw materials and resources. It’s yours! But now, hostile players can push your position and lay claim to the workshop. Once you pay, the workshop’s flag will rise high into the air. The cost varies depending on which workshop you’re claiming. Once clear, head on over to the workshop (the orange/red table), and activate it, which costs a bit of caps. To claim one, clear the immediate area of enemies and mutated monsters. To take advantage of the many benefits a workshop offers, you must first claim one for yourself.
